Allergic Rhinitis is one of the most prevailing human diseases that can lead to certain restrictions in physical, psychological and social aspects of life, and which can trigger life quality degradation, sleep disturbances, and in severe cases may adversely impact the tuition process or even a vocational life of a patient. This is a chronic ailment linked with inflammatory mediated IgE-reaction to an allergenic agent, which is clinically manifested through nasal discharge, obstructed nasal breathing, ptarmus and itchiness inside of a nasal cavity[l, 2, 3]. In Kazakhstan at present more than 25% of adults and more than 16% of children have been suffering from Allergic Rhinitis (AR), their number equals to about 5 mln. persons.
